Question
What procedure is used for new demands or requests?
Problem description
To enable carers, clients and people who are not working in the mental health field to make demands or requests, we are operating with a low threshold procedure, causing an saturation of the caseload in a very short period
Impact - effect
Consequently there’s the risk that the persons most likely to benefit who benefit the most form a 2B-team follow up could be the first to miss the boat. After all, they have the greatest impact on the workload, and by consequence on what is feasible as maximum caseload
To do
To do: working on a procedure for the reception of demands that is nonetheless sufficiently responding to the objective of a low threshold (easy accessible), while at the same time responding to a thorough screening so we will follow up only these persons that are meant to be followed up by a 2B-team
